Schottky Barrier Chip
Guard Ring Die Construction for Transient Protection
Low Power Loss, High Efficiency
High Surge Capability
High Current Capability and Low Forward Voltage Drop
For Use in Low Voltage, High Frequency Inverters, Free
Wheeling, and Polarity Protection Applications
Lead Free Finish, RoHS Compliant (Note 3)
Case: TO-3P
Case Material: Molded Plastic. UL Flammability
Classification Rating 94V-0
Moisture Sensitivity: Level 1 per J-STD-020C
Terminals: Finish - Bright Tin. Plated Leads Solderable per
MIL-STD-202, Method 208
Polarity: As Marked on Body
Ordering Information: See Last Page
Marking: Type Number
Weight: 5.6 grams (approximate)
1. Thermal resistance junction to case mounted on heatsink.
2. Measured at 1.0MHz and applied reverse voltage of 4.0V DC.
3. RoHS revision 13.2.2003. Glass and High Temperature Solder Exemptions Applied, see EU Directive Annex Notes 5 and 7.
